Marvel Font


The “Marvel Font” refers to the distinctive typographic style used in Marvel Comics branding, cover logos, and marketing materials. While Marvel doesn’t officially release a single unified font, several typefaces capture its iconic comic-book aesthetic. Marvel has been a leading comic book publisher since 1939, creating legendary superheroes like Spider-Man, Iron Man, and Captain America.

What Font is the Marvel Logo?

Marvel’s Official Logo Font (Modern Era)

Key Features: Clean, geometric, slightly condensed, with sharp terminals.

Marvel-logo-v-Benton-Sans-Compressed-Black

Current Marvel Logo: Uses a customized sans-serif typeface (similar to Benton Sans Bold Condensed), refined for cinematic branding (e.g., Marvel Studios). It is a part of the font family of Benton Sans, and Tobias Frere-Jones designed the font in 1995. Later, in 2003, additional widths, weights, and italics to the typeface family were added by Cyrus Highsmith and released by Font Bureau. The font is based on Morris Fuller Benton’s News Gothic.

There is another font created in 2019 by YbtFonts, also called Marvel. This font is a handwritten script font that has a playful and casual feel. It is suitable for creating logos, titles, posters, invitations, and more. It has uppercase, lowercase, numerals, punctuation, and multilingual support.

Marvel Studios used the capital version as their base font for the logo. The logo font draws the letters closer together. The bold and compact design of the font makes it a perfect choice for impactful headlines and logos.

Classic Comic Book Title Fonts

For vintage Marvel comics (e.g., Spider-ManX-Men), these fonts dominate:

Badaboom” – The quintessential Marvel comic title font (designed by Blambot). Mimics hand-drawn lettering from 1960s–2000s comics. Use: Fan projects, merch (non-commercial OK; commercial requires license). “BadaBoom BB” (Blambot’s digital version). Includes alternate characters for authenticity.

Komika Title” (by Apostrophic Labs) – Free alternative inspired by Marvel.

How to Achieve the Marvel Style

  • For Logos: Use bold condensed sans-serifs (e.g., Benton Sans, League Spartan) with tweaks (sharp edges, slight slant).
  • For Comic Text:
    • Titles: Badaboom or Marvel Font by Fontfabric.
    • Body Text: Classic comic lettering fonts like “Wild Words” or “Action Man”

Marvel Comic Font

Most comics use an all-caps font—uppercase letters aid in keeping the layout and structure of the page uniform. But based on our research Marvel comics is similar to Comic Sans, Fakt Soft Pro and Whizbang font.

  • Comic Sans: This is one of the most famous and controversial fonts in the world. It was designed by Vincent Connare in 1994 for Microsoft, and it was inspired by comic book lettering. It has a casual and playful look, with irregular shapes and curves. It is often criticized for being overused and inappropriate for professional or serious contexts, but it is still popular among comic book fans and creators.
  • Fakt Soft Pro: This is a sans serif font designed by Thomas Thiemich in 2010 for OurType. It has a friendly and warm appearance, with soft edges and rounded terminals. It is suitable for comic book titles and captions, as it has a variety of weights and styles to choose from.
  • Whizbang: This is a comic book font designed by Andre Kuzniarek in 1993. It has a retro and fun feel, with exaggerated shapes and angles. It is ideal for comic book dialogues, as it has upper and lower case letters, punctuation marks and symbols.
